Adrienne Bailon never told 'The Real' co-hosts she was on 'The Masked Singer'

Imagine working with your co-worker for months and not knowing that she is living a double life? Well, that’s basically what happened with Adrienne Bailon and her co-hosts on The Real.

Bailon’s co-hosts — Tamera Mowry, Jeannie Mai, and Loni Love — had suspected that the singer was the Pink Flamingo on The Masked Singer back in September — and they were right. But Bailon managed to keep it a secret from her co-hosts until the end.

On a pre-recorded episode of The Real that aired Thursday, the hosts were told that they were going to interview one of the finalists from The Masked Singer. What they didn’t know is that they were sitting right next to her: Adrienne Bailon.

After keeping the secret for months, Bailon finally got to sit down with them and spill the tea on the show and her experience. Bailon, who came in third place on the show, revealed that while doing The Masked Singer she suffered from panic attacks brought on by insecurities over her voice. She also had difficulty breathing in her costume.

Bailon went on to talk about how hard it was to keep this a secret from her co-hosts, especially when she was confronted on a previous episode of The Real and denied all indications that she could ever be on The Masked Singer.
